Letters Gujarat verdict The Gujarat poll verdict has reaffirmed the electorates’ faith in Mr Narendra Modi’s able administration. The convincing victory is testimony to the fact that voters will respond positively if developmental activities coupled with good governance are provided in the State. Perhaps, this is the first time that prices of shares of state companies rose sharply because of re-election of a chief minister. This further proves the importance of economic development.
